This two-bedroom house, located at 34 Highland Road, Bexleyheath, DA6 7LZ, was built between 1930 and 1949 as an end-terrace property. It features fully double-glazed windows and has a pitched roof with 250mm loft insulation. The property has a current energy rating of 'D' and a potential energy rating of 'B'. The main heating system is a boiler and radiators, powered by mains gas.
